How to build trust and set yourself apart with Linda Lucas
from Lawyer Launcher - Behind the Bar · host Susan Van Dyke
In this episode, I’m joined by Linda Lucas—a longtime law firm and professional services executive and now a sought-after leadership coach and trainer. With 25+ years of strategic, operational, and financial leadership experience, Linda shares practical insights every law student, summer/articling student, and new lawyer needs to hear.Her core message: leadership starts on day one, not when you get a title.What you’ll learn (and why it matters early in your career):• How to be a leader at any level Small daily habits build your long-term reputation and influence.• Why “thinking like an owner” sets you apart Students who take responsibility for their work get noticed—fast.• The behaviours that build trust Integrity, accountability, follow-through, honesty, courage, and truly listening.
